Carteret is a borough located in Middlesex County, New Jersey. Carteret has a 2025 population of 26,179 . Carteret is currently growing at a rate of 0.68% annually and its population has increased by 3.49%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 25,297 in 2020.
The average household income in Carteret is $111,904 with a poverty rate of 10.02%. The median age in Carteret is 39.3 years: 40.1 years for males, and 38.6 years for females. For every 100 females there are 94.3 males.

The racial composition of Carteret includes 27.22% White, 24.47% Asian, 17.33% Black or African American, 12.17% other race, and smaller percentages for Native American,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ander and multiracial populations.

Race | Population |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 6,856 | 27.22% |
| Asian | 6,163 | 24.47% |
| Two or more races | 4,552 | 18.07% |
| Black or African American | 4,366 | 17.33% |
| Other race | 3,065 | 12.17% |
| Native American | 156 | 0.62% |
|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 29 | 0.12% |

Carteret's average per capita income is $49,252. Household income levels show a median of $87,553. The poverty rate stands at 10.02%.
Name | Median |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$110,755 | - |
| Families | $95,844 | $122,652 |
| Households | $87,553 | $111,904 |
| Non Families | $54,217 | $58,568 |
